Transaction 2539a99ffdfadf3578f0f497f561b932a97ad77728d184bb2decb0c490d3becc

2 Input
2 Outputs
  • 2539a99ffdfadf3578f0f497f561b932a97ad77728d184bb2decb0c490d3becc:0
  • value  39954
    address  17fTUyZ25bR2heSLUgpgecPv9fm4AnciKc
  • 2539a99ffdfadf3578f0f497f561b932a97ad77728d184bb2decb0c490d3becc:1
  • value  524000
    address  3GahMChEnGXt1FN4yUUfurBDEpneCMJy9o